The Rise of Adult Bunk Beds: A Practical Solution for Shared Spaces

In the last few years, the demand for adult bunk beds has risen, showing a growing trend towards shared living arrangements and more compact, effective usage of space. As urbanization boosts and real estate costs increase, people are significantly seeking ingenious services to accommodate multiple roomies, relative, or visitors in a single residence. Go into adult bunk beds-- a clever style that integrates functionality with convenience, appealing to those looking to maximize their home while maintaining a trendy and cozy atmosphere.

Advantages of Adult Bunk Beds

Adult bunk beds use several benefits over traditional sleeping plans:

Space-Saving: By stacking beds vertically, bunk beds can occupy much less floor area compared to side-by-side twin beds or bigger songs. This is especially helpful in small studios, visitor spaces, or home workplaces with minimal square footage.

Economical: Purchasing a bunk bed frequently shows more economical than buying different beds, especially when thinking about the cost savings on bed frames, bed mattress, and bed linen.

Functionality: Bunk beds can be easily transformed into a storage system by adding racks, drawers, or cabinets underneath the lower bed, supplying a convenient place for baggage, linens, or office materials.

Sense of Community: When bunk beds are used in shared areas, they foster a sense of togetherness and sociability among occupants, encouraging social interaction and a feeling of belonging.

Design Versatility: Modern adult bunk beds come in a large range of designs, materials, and setups to match different decoration preferences and requirements. From standard to minimalist, commercial to luxury, the options are unlimited.

Design Considerations for Adult Bunk Beds

When choosing an adult bunk bed, several factors must be taken into consideration:

Height and Accessibility: Ensure the bunk bed's total height and individual bed risers enable simple entry and exit, especially if occupants have movement concerns.

Strength and Safety: Look for sturdy constructions with safe ladder attachments and guardrails to prevent falls. Sturdy bed frames and solid mattresses are also essential for a comfortable night's sleep.

Storage and Organization: Consider the available space underneath the lower bed and how it can be used for storage. Drawers, racks, or cabinets can assist keep mess at bay and preserve a tidy living environment.

Bed Mattress Quality and Size: Choose top quality, breathable mattresses in the appropriate sizes for each bed (twin, full, queen, and so on). Ensure the bed mattress are comfortable and encouraging for a relaxing sleep.

Style and Aesthetics: Select a bunk bed that harmonizes with the desired room design and color scheme. Consider the total visual effect, in addition to the ease of cleaning and upkeep.
